The Stockholm School of Economics ranked 13th in Sweden, 1145th in the global 2026 rating, and scored in the TOP 50% across 96 research topics. The Stockholm School of Economics ranking is based on 3 factors: research output (EduRank's index has 7,751 academic publications and 411,148 citations attributed to the university), non-academic reputation, and the impact of 94 notable alumni.
